GRANDMA SZUHAY’S APPLE CAKE
1 cup vegetable oil
3 whole eggs
1 cup fine sugar
¾ cups packed brown s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la
½ teaspoon salt
2 cups all purpose flour
1 teaspoon cinnamon
5 apples peeled, cored and diced
1 cup walnuts
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ees then grease and flour a 9 x 13 cake pan.
In a mixing bowl combine the first five ingredients. Add all the other ingredients except for the apples and the walnuts. Batter will be thick so use an electric mixer. Fold in the apples and the walnuts then spread into the pan. Bake for 1 hour or until a toothpick comes out clean. Let cake cool slightly then serve warm to your guests with powdered sugar or freshly whipped cream.
